Onions are packed with natural compounds that can support your body in quiet but meaningful ways. They contain antioxidants and sulfur-based nutrients that may help your body respond better to insulin. When insulin works well, it helps move sugar from your blood into your cells, where it is needed for energy. Onions also have some fiber, which helps slow down how quickly sugar is absorbed. This can help you avoid sudden drops or spikes that leave you feeling unwell.
Preparing onions doesn’t have to be complicated. You can simply peel and slice one, then add it to your salad or food. If the taste feels too strong, soaking the slices in water for a few minutes can make them milder. Some people prefer lightly cooking them, which still keeps many of their benefits while making them easier to eat.
Still, it’s important to stay grounded. Onions are helpful, but they are not a quick fix or a cure. If your blood sugar keeps dropping often, that is a sign you need proper attention. Regular meals, staying hydrated, and following medical advice matter much more than any single food.
